Pointe De Montrémian
Pointe de Montrémian is a coastal dive site near the French Riviera, typically accessed from nearby towns along the Hyères to Saint-Tropez coastline. The area features rocky shelves and seabed transitions that support a range of Mediterranean fauna. Expect gentle to moderate currents and clear water conditions in calm weather. Access is via shore entry or boat drop-off from nearby harbours, with entry points suitable for reef and wall dives. Common species in the region include groupers, reef fish, moray eels, octopus, and various wrasses, with posidonia seagrass meadows often visible on the sandier bottoms. The site is suitable for recreational divers with standard training and provides a straightforward introduction to Western Mediterranean underwater topography.
